The French verb "attendre" means "to wait" in English. It is a regular verb. Below you'll find the complete conjugation tables for "attendre" across all 5 tenses. New to French verbs? Start with the French verb guide.

How to Conjugate "attendre" in the Present Tense

Présent de l'indicatif Actions happening now or regularly
Person English Conjugation
je I attends
tu you (informal) attends
il/elle/on he/she/one attend
nous we attendons
vous you (formal/plural) attendez
ils/elles they attendent
Il attend une réponse importante.
He is waiting for an important answer.

How to Conjugate "attendre" in the Past (completed) Tense

Passé composé Actions completed in the past
Person English Conjugation
je I ai attendu
tu you (informal) as attendu
il/elle/on he/she/one a attendu
nous we avons attendu
vous you (formal/plural) avez attendu
ils/elles they ont attendu
Elle a attendu son ami.
She waited for her friend.

How to Conjugate "attendre" in the Past (ongoing) Tense

Imparfait Actions that were ongoing in the past
Person English Conjugation
je I attendais
tu you (informal) attendais
il/elle/on he/she/one attendait
nous we attendions
vous you (formal/plural) attendiez
ils/elles they attendaient
Il attendait une réponse importante.
He was waiting for an important answer.

How to Conjugate "attendre" in the Future Tense

Futur simple Actions that will happen
Person English Conjugation
je I attendrai
tu you (informal) attendras
il/elle/on he/she/one attendra
nous we attendrons
vous you (formal/plural) attendrez
ils/elles they attendront
Elle attendra son ami à la sortie.
She will wait for her friend at the exit.

How to Conjugate "attendre" in the Would (conditional) Tense

Conditionnel présent Hypothetical actions
Person English Conjugation
je I attendrais
tu you (informal) attendrais
il/elle/on he/she/one attendrait
nous we attendrions
vous you (formal/plural) attendriez
ils/elles they attendraient
Elle attendrait le train.
She would wait for the train.

Frequently Asked Questions About "attendre"

Is "attendre" regular or irregular in French?
"Attendre" is a regular French verb that follows standard conjugation patterns for its verb group.
What does "attendre" mean in English?
The French verb "attendre" means "to wait" in English.
How do you conjugate "attendre" in the present tense?
In the present tense (Présent de l'indicatif): je → attends, tu → attends, il/elle/on → attend, nous → attendons, vous → attendez, ils/elles → attendent.
